Some friends and I who go way back to the launch of LotR TCG have been playtesting what we call Expanded Fellowship format. This is a "house rules" format that we've played on and off over the years, but we got serious about playtesting it since spring.

I've mentioned this format a few times in forum posts and on GEMP, but have been reluctant to share it until we had more games under our belts and were generally settled on the X- and R-Lists.

The goal of this format: Revitalize Fellowship Block
by inhibiting frustrating and abusive strategies and introducing new cards that rebalance the game and enable underplayed cards or cultures.

Our approach is to keep things as simple as possible: We included new sets not individual cards, we eschew errata, and we apply X- or R-list decisions that primarily originate from Decipher's own Expanded format.

Why Fellowship Block? Besides that it's our favorite format, Fellowship is probably still the most accessible format for new and old players.

I'll share the tl;dr rules below. I also have a longer doc with some of our rationale if you're keen for a more in-depth look.

Expanded Fellowship Format
Legal Sets
  • Fellowship Block sets
  • Reflections
  • Wraith Collection
  • Age's End

Rules
  • Ringbearer skirmishes can not be cancelled.
  • Frodo must be the starting ringbearer, as per the original rulebook.
  • All loaded and unloaded keywords on legal cards are in play, including Threats, Ringbound, and Enduring.

We applied X-List decisions where Decipher's original rationale (https://lotrtcgwiki.com/forums/index.php/topic,120.msg35699.html#msg35699) made sense in this format. We moved just a few X-Listed cards to the R-List in part because we felt they were less abusive in this format (Sam remains the hotly contested exception), but also because we wanted to maximize the cards available.

Some cards were added to the X-List only after much playtesting. For example, The Balrog, Demon of Might was a staple of decks for a long time (it had a fascinating affect on Free Peoples deckbuilding) until a player decided to create a deck that exploited it -- to everyone's chagrin. It became clear there was no way to control this card without an errata, which we did not want to do.

I've played 16 Wraiths just a few times in this format. I like them because they are different and internally cohesive. Undead of Angmar has been my focus so far — not only does he become big by bringing out other Wraiths, he lowers the ringbearer's resistance, which makes playing Gollum, Dark as Darkness and Thin and Stretched or DDotR tempting.

Because most Fship block Ringwraith cards only target Nazgul, there's not much synergy there. Ithil Stone is the greatest complement to them, and pairs well with Orc Taskmaster. Morgul Skulker and Ulaire Otsea, Lieutenant of Morgul provide some benefits as well. In Twilight seems good on paper, but there's no real value in the draw, it can be easily outwitted, and for the 2TL you can play a smaller Wraith who helps with spotting.

I know not many people are reading this thread (let alone trying Expanded Fellowship), but for the record, GavinH and I finally made the call to add 19P30 Pippin, Steadfast Friend to this format's x-list.

As you can imagine, Pippin quickly became a staple in every deck — Gondor, Elves, Dwarves, Hobbits — often fighting at Str 10 or more with just a sword, riding on the coattails of Tales (no pun intended).
